掌握虚拟主机开启步骤攻略

虚拟主机 0

​掌握虚拟主机开启步骤攻略:从入门到精通​

在数字化浪潮中,无论是个人博客、企业官网还是电商平台,​​虚拟主机​​已成为搭建网站的基石。然而,许多新手面对“如何开启虚拟主机”这一问题仍感到困惑——从选择服务商到配置环境,每一步都可能成为拦路虎。本文将以实战经验为核心,拆解虚拟主机开启的全流程,助你快速上手。

掌握虚拟主机开启步骤攻略


​为什么虚拟主机是建站首选?​
虚拟主机的核心优势在于​​低成本​​和​​易用性​​。它通过虚拟化技术将一台物理服务器分割为多个独立空间,每个空间可运行独立的网站,共享硬件资源但互不干扰。例如,个人开发者仅需每年几百元即可获得稳定的主机服务,而无需承担独立服务器的高额成本。

常见误区: 有人认为虚拟主机性能不足,实际上,​​共享型主机​​适合流量较小的网站,而​​VPS或云虚拟主机​​可灵活扩展资源,满足中高流量需求。


​第一步:选择服务商与套餐​
​1. 评估需求​

  • ​流量预估​​:日均访问量低于1000的博客可选择共享主机,电商网站建议选择独立IP或云虚拟主机。
  • ​操作系统​​:Linux(适合PHP、Python)或Windows(支持ASP.NET)。

​2. 对比服务商​

​指标​​推荐选择​
稳定性99.9%以上在线率(如腾讯云、阿里云)
技术支持提供24/7人工客服
价格透明度避免隐藏费用,优先选择按年付费优惠套餐

​个人建议:​​ 新手可优先试用提供​​免费体验期​​的服务商,如腾讯云的基础型主机。


​第二步:购买与基础配置​
​1. 注册与购买​

  • 登录服务商官网(如腾讯云),选择“云虚拟主机”套餐,按提示完成支付。
  • ​注意​​:购买时需确认是否包含域名(如无,需额外注册)。

​2. 域名绑定与解析​

  • 在控制面板中添加域名(如www.example.com)。
  • 在域名注册商处​​修改DNS记录​​,将域名指向虚拟主机的IP地址(通常需等待1-48小时生效)。

​常见问题:​​ 若域名解析失败,检查DNS是否填写正确,或尝试清除本地DNS缓存(命令:ipconfig /flushdns)。


​第三步:服务器环境搭建​
​1. Web服务器安装​

  • ​Linux系统​​:通过SSH连接后,运行命令安装Nginx或Apache:
  • ​Windows系统​​:通过远程桌面连接,使用可视化面板(如宝塔)一键部署。

​2. 虚拟主机配置(以Nginx为例)​

  • 编辑配置文件(路径:/etc/nginx/sites-available/your_site),添加以下内容:
  • 创建符号链接激活配置: 提示:完成后重启Nginx(sudo systemctl restart nginx)。

​第四步:网站部署与测试​
​1. 文件上传​

  • 使用FTP工具(如FileZilla)连接主机,将网站文件上传至指定目录(如/public_html)。
  • ​权限设置​​:确保目录权限为755,文件权限为644(命令:chmod -R 755 /var/www/your_site)。

​2. 数据库配置​

  • 在控制面板中创建MySQL数据库,记录用户名、密码。
  • 修改网站配置文件(如WordPress的wp-config.php)填入数据库信息。

​测试阶段:​​ 浏览器输入域名,若显示“403 Forbidden”,检查目录权限或.htaccess文件。


​高阶技巧与避坑指南​
​1. 多站点管理​

  • 同一主机可通过​​不同端口​​或​​子域名​​托管多个网站。例如:

​2. 安全加固​

  • ​防火墙规则​​:仅开放必要端口(如80、443、22)。
  • ​SSL证书​​:使用Let’s Encrypt免费证书,强制HTTPS加密。

​独家数据:​​ 2025年统计显示,未配置SSL的网站用户流失率高达​​53%​​,而HTTPS可提升搜索引擎排名。


虚拟主机的开启并非一蹴而就,但通过​​分步实践​​和​​问题排查​​,即使零基础用户也能在1小时内完成部署。记住,​​稳定的服务商+正确的配置=高效建站​​。现在,你可以告别“虚拟主机太难”的焦虑,自信地迈出第一步了!